Role of intra operative cholangiogram in current day practice.

Shailesh Mohandas1, Ajo Kureekattu John.   

Abstract

The role of Intra Operative Cholangiogram during laparoscopic cholecystectomy remains controversial. This review discusses the modalities used in the pre- and peri-operative assessment of Common Bile Duct. It also discusses the advantages and disadvantages of selective and routine IOC. In this review we explore the role of Intra Operative Cholangiogram in current day practice.
